NVIDIA's GeForce GTX 560: The Top To Bottom Factory Overclock

NVIDIA’s GF104 and GF114 GPUs have been a solid success for the company so far. 10 months after GF104 launched the GTX 460 series, NVIDIA has slowly been supplementing and replacing their former $200 king. In January we saw the launch of the GF114 based GTX 560 Ti, which gave us our first look at what a fully enabled GF1x4 GPU could do. However the GTX 560 Ti was positioned above the GTX 460 series in both performance and price, so it was more an addition to their lineup than a replacement for GTX 460.

With each GF11x GPU effectively being a half-step above its GF10x predecessor, NVIDIA’s replacement strategy has been to split a 400 series card’s original market between two GF11x GPUs. For the GTX 460, on the low-end this was partially split off into the GTX 550 Ti, which came fairly close to the GTX 460 768MB’s performance. The GTX 460 1GB has remained in place however, and today NVIDIA is finally starting to change that with the GeForce GTX 560. Based upon the same GF114 GPU as the GTX 560 Ti, the GTX 560 will be the GTX 460 1GB’s eventual high-end successor and NVIDIA’s new $200 card.

NVIDIA's Project Kal-El: Quad-Core A9s Coming to Smartphones/Tablets This Year

NVIDIA just dropped a bombshell. Not only is its third generation Tegra architecture, codenamed Kal-El, back from the fab but it's up and running Android after only 12 days. Kal-El will begin sampling soon and NVIDIA claims you'll be able to buy tablets based on it in August of this year, with smartphones following before the end of the year.

NVIDIA's GeForce GTX 560 Ti: Upsetting The $250 Market

Late last year we saw GF110, the first of the revised Fermi family. Utilizing a new low-level transistor design intended to minimize transistor leakage, GF110 brought with it GTX 580 and GTX 570, a pair of powerful if expensive video cards that put NVIDIA back where they traditionally lie on the performance/power curve: very high performance with only moderately high power consumption.

Now with 1 GPU’s revisions under their belts, it’s time for NVIDIA to take to tinkering the next GPU:  GF104. Receiving the same transistor reworking as GF100/GF110 in order to allow NVIDIA to enable all of GF104’s functional units, it has become the aptly named GF114. And it is the heart of NVIDIA’s newest video card: the GeForce GTX 560 Ti. Will the GTX 560 Ti follow in the footsteps of its predecessor and shake up the $200 market? Let’s find out.

NVIDIA's Tegra 2 Take Two: More Architectural Details and Design Wins

Twelve months ago NVIDIA stood on stage at CES and introduced its Tegra 2 SoC. It promised dozens of design wins and smartphones shipping before Spring 2010. That obviously did not happen.

What instead happened was NVIDIA lost a number of design wins, many of which we centered around mobile OSes other than Android. There were a number of Windows Mobile/Windows CE based designs that never made it to market, and a lot of efforts around earlier versions of Android that never went anywhere.

In the time since NVIDIA’s CES 2010 announcement, the company has shifted resources and focused its entire Tegra team on a single OS: Android. Choosing Android isn’t a hard decision to understand, of all of the available smartphone OS options it has the most momentum behind it.
